顯示廣告
隱藏 ✕
※ 本文為 dinos 轉寄自 ptt.cc 更新時間: 2014-06-21 08:32:10
看板 Soft_Job
作者 wens (泉湧)
標題 Re: [請益] 想學Embeded Linux
時間 Sat Jun 21 01:22:12 2014


剛好看到,回應一下

※ 引述《Ferrara (紅燒冰淇淋)》之銘言:
: 小弟已經在職 工作是通訊軟體工程師
: 平常日8點左右下班 人在台北
:
: 因為平常工作摸不到Embeded Linux
: 但又覺得很重要 所以想找個在職班學一下
: 希望能摸到Kernel 還有CortexM,ARM

你想玩的是完整的 SoC? 還是 CortexM 或 Ardruino 這類的MCU?

是想做 driver porting, android, 還是什麼呢?

工具,程式,平台都不一樣呢

: 大概看過台交大 還有資策會開的在職班課程
: 目前查到的課程都比較不符需求
: 所以想請問還有什麼地方友開設這類課程可以讓人報名

這東西非常的硬,要看看電機或資工的實驗課程,或許沒有開放外面的人修
jserv 在成大開的課,主要是講 MCU 的: http://wiki.csie.ncku.edu.tw/

如果你是想玩 Cortex-A 類型的, 有 MMU 的, 就去買張實驗版來玩玩吧
不要買 Rpi, 選擇也不少, beagle bone, cubieboard, odroid,
買來自己動手找資料裝個 linux, 看看能跑什麼, 了解手上硬體的特性跟功能,
再來看看自己可以動手寫什麼

很多資料都是英文的, 可以看看今年 embedded linux conf 的投影片跟錄音

投影片: http://events.linuxfoundation.org/events/embedded-linux-conference/program/slides
錄音檔: http://events.linuxfoundation.org/events/embedded-linux-conference/program/audio-recordings

這邊也有些訓練課程的教材 (點進最上面四個課程後, 有 training material):

    http://free-electrons.com/training/
Embedded Linux, kernel, drivers, real-time, Android and Yocto training Public and on-site training sessions for developers of kernel drivers, real-time, embedded Linux and Android systems. ...

 

教材怎麼樣我說不準, 但至少有參考價值


之後,要玩 linux 就要去跟 mailing list, 看看大家在幹嘛
ARM 的話就跟 LAKML (linux-arm-kernel mailing list)
如果你不想每天信箱都被塞爆, 可以到 patchwork 上面看 patch:

    https://patchwork.kernel.org/project/linux-arm-kernel/list/

或是其他的 mailing list archive


: 非常感謝
:
: --
: 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 219.70.204.146
: ※ 文章網址: http://www.ptt.cc/bbs/Tech_Job/M.1402667460.A.CFD.html
: → eva19452002:自己先買塊板子先玩看看,網路上的資源很多,不見得要  06/13 22:19
: → eva19452002:上課                                                06/13 22:19
: → Ferrara:想上課的原因是希望能有個書面修課證明 有助將來轉職       06/13 22:20
: → Ferrara:自己在家玩 比較沒說服力                                 06/13 22:20

只要做出有用的東西,commit log 打開一目了然。書面證明有什麼用?

另外我不知道台灣這類工作多不多,可能多數集中在硬體廠

自己玩是不錯啦,可以學到不少硬體的東西

: ※ 發信站: 批踢踢實業坊(ptt.cc)
: ※ 轉錄者: Ferrara (219.70.204.146), 06/13/2014 22:22:47
: → playkkk:印象中傳識有開過                                        06/14 01:38
: → playkkk:查了一下才發現傳識收掉了 =_=                            06/14 01:43
: 推 wandog:要有作品,在家玩沒關係                                   06/14 02:16
: 推 za7788az:找找 jserv大 在大學開的課 他應該會很樂意指導的         06/14 03:53
: → xsoho:可以開"學習"專案讀書會之類的嗎?                           06/14 10:02
: → kingofsdtw:Embeded其實是賽缺 系統廠要弄懂很多IC 不深但是廣      06/15 07:03
: → kingofsdtw:IC多到SPEC看不完,整天debug.IC廠SPEC又藏東西         06/15 07:04
: → kingofsdtw:去玩玩可以,但別當職業生涯                           06/15 07:04
: → kingofsdtw:起薪高,用肝堆出來,但基本上薪資到頂就那樣           06/15 07:05
: → kingofsdtw:除非進IC廠熟自家公司的IC即可                         06/15 07:07

多數廠商 spec sheet 只會給有簽約的客戶,可能還要簽 NDA
TI 跟 Altera 好像比較好一點,google 也是可以找到不少東西啦
但 spec sheet 也不見得是完整的,有些 IP 是跟別人買的,也會有限制
要玩這麼硬就去IC廠吧,MTK, Qualcomm, Synopsys 之類的

--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.112.30.76
※ 文章網址: http://www.ptt.cc/bbs/Soft_Job/M.1403284934.A.E2C.html
hpo14:推1F 06/21 01:24

--
※ 看板: dinos 文章推薦值: 0 目前人氣: 0 累積人氣: 1239 
※ 本文也出現在看板: ott
分享網址: 複製 已複製
guest
x)推文 r)回覆 e)編輯 d)刪除 M)收藏 ^x)轉錄 同主題: =)首篇 [)上篇 ])下篇